Diet Coke has announced the return of its Retro Diet Coke Lime flavor for a limited nationwide release. The beverage, which combines the traditional zero-sugar Diet Coke with a citrus lime twist, was previously available from 2004 to 2018 and is making a comeback in response to consumer demand.
The limited-time product will be available across the United States in 12 packs of 12-ounce cans and single 20-ounce PET bottles. Distribution will include grocery stores, convenience stores, mass retail channels, and select online platforms.
The packaging for Retro Diet Coke Lime will feature nostalgic design elements inspired by the original look, similar to the recent Retro Diet Cherry Coke release that was offered exclusively at Kroger stores.
Ryan Watson, brand director for Diet Coke North America, stated, “We spend a lot of time listening to what our consumers are saying online. People have been signing petitions and DM-ing us asking for flavors from the past, including cherry and lime. We take all of that into account before doing extensive qualitative research and testing to determine our next offerings.”
The new can design incorporates neon lime graphics with the classic Diet Coke branding, aiming to attract both longtime fans and younger consumers interested in novelty products.
